SF 647: A bill for an act relating to and making appropriations to the education system, including the funding and operation of the department for the blind, department of education, and state board of regents, and including contingent effective date provisions.
Topics
✓ Budget & TaxesSupports Budget & TaxesAllocates state funding to education departments and blind services, directly supporting budget appropriations for public education programs.
✓ EducationSupports EducationBill allocates state funding to education departments and agencies, directly advancing operational resources for K-12 and higher education services per appropriations language.

HSB 62: A bill for an act requiring that a portion of funds for the Iowa tuition grant be awarded to students pursuing majors leading to high-wage and high-demand jobs and including effective date provisions.
Topics
✓ Budget & TaxesSupports Budget & TaxesRedirects existing tuition grant funds to high-demand fields, prioritizing fiscal efficiency in education spending per budget allocation criteria.
✓ EducationSupports EducationRedirects tuition grant funds to high-demand majors, increasing targeted educational access for workforce-aligned programs without restricting traditional education.
✓ Labor & EmploymentSupports Labor & EmploymentDirectly ties tuition grants to high-wage, high-demand jobs, aligning education funding with labor market needs to improve future employment outcomes and earnings potential.
